Transaction 4838eccc09bc37af4cbeac3fb8d918bf05b79a4bb1425c2edda1ae60af91d226

2 Input
1 Outputs
  • 4838eccc09bc37af4cbeac3fb8d918bf05b79a4bb1425c2edda1ae60af91d226:0
  • value  2599769
    address  3EnUd5XraaFNdAQyrSwptAcA3TjEvbHKYW